On the decay mode $Λ_b \to X_s γ$
We study the inclusive $H_b \to X_s γ$ decay with $H_b$ a beauty baryon, in particular $Λ_b$, employing an expansion in the heavy quark mass at $\mathit{O}(m_b^{-3})$ at leading order in $α_s$, keeping the dependence on the hadron spin. For a polarized baryon we compute the distribution $\displaystyle\frac{d^2Γ}{dy \, d \cos θ_P}$, with $y=2E_γ/m_b$, $E_γ$ the photon energy and $θ_P$ the angle between the baryon spin vector and the photon momentum in the $H_b$ rest-frame. We discuss the correlation between the baryon and photon polarization, and show that effects of physics beyond the Standard Model can modify the photon polarization asymmetry. We also discuss a method to treat the singular terms in the photon energy spectrum obtained by the OPE.
